Management Meeting Minutes — Warranty Overrun

Attendees: senior team, Orvella Manufacturing. Kessner walked the board through the warranty-cost overrun on the Duntley pump line — roughly 22% over forecast, mostly seal failures from the Marbeck plant batch. Fix is underway and claims are slowing. We agreed to tighten supplier checks and revisit reserves next quarter. One more item needs your attention, set out confidentially below.

board note of tadup-tajog: Headcount on the Oliiel team goes from 31 to 88 by the end of February. Gross margin on Oliiel came in at 62 percent against a plan of 29 percent.

☐ Step 4 — Gridloom puzzle signing. New members: the Gridloom crossword generator signs each published grid so solvers can verify puzzles weren't altered after review. During the key ceremony, two witnesses confirm the signing key was generated on the air-gapped Hollowpine workstation and never copied elsewhere. Initial the ledger once both witnesses agree. The signing key shards are then sealed, and restoring them later requires the recovery passphrase recorded below.

unlock words, yawig-kagef: gordor-holvan-ulaael-pramir-ulaiel-tamdor

## Changelog — Ladlewise 3.2

Heads up, maintainers: we changed the default scaling behavior. Previously Ladlewise rounded all scaled quantities to the nearest quarter unit, which made bakers in the Fennwick test group grumpy about yeast amounts. Now rounding is ingredient-aware and spice quantities scale logarithmically past 4x, matching the Tarrow kitchen study. Metric output is also on by default. If you relied on the old behavior, pin the legacy profile. The new defaults ship as follows.

deployment values, faduf-tawep:
SORDOR_LOG_LEVEL=error
SORDOR_METRICS_HOST=metrics.sordor.nelvrolabs.internal
SORDOR_POOL_SIZE=4

## Deployment

Brambleworks ships the digest scheduler (`hivemail-digest`) via the standard pipeline: merge to main, auto-deploy to staging, manual promote to prod. Digest windows are timezone-bucketed; a deploy mid-window is safe because in-flight batches drain first. For the eng sync: prod promotion is gated on the staging soak passing twice. Prod runs with the configuration shown below.

config for kagup-hahig:
druwyn:
  pin: 2801
  metrics_host: metrics.druwyn.zemvarlabs.internal
  tenant: sorius
  seal: seal_798a43d7